LA International New Music Festival
Presented by Southwest Chamber Music

May 9-26, 2012

At the acoustically superb Zipper Concert Hall at the Colburn School, Los Angeles

The inaugural LA International New Music Festival brings together composers and their works from all over the globe to rest in the heart of LA: the Grand Avenue Arts Corridor downtown.

Grammy® Award-winning Southwest Chamber Music presents this celebration of its 25th anniversary season with premieres and commissions from fifteen composers representing Asia, Europe, Latin American and the US.
